A source said that Darrisaw will sign his contract before the team begins Friday afternoon a three-day rookie minicamp. The Virginia Tech product will get a four-year, $13.35 million contract and will have an option for a fifth year. He will receive a $7.066 million signing bonus, and will count $2.426 million on the 2021 salary cap.

Interesting stat from HokieSports:
The only previous time that Virginia Tech landed two selections in the first round of the same NFL Draft was in 2018 when LB Tremaine Edmunds went 16th overall to Buffalo and his brother, Terrell, went 28th overall to Pittsburgh. That would mark four first-round picks for the Hokies in the past four drafts, a total only six other schools can top over that span β Alabama (18), Ohio State (8), LSU & Georgia (7) and Clemson (6).
